Bowen Therapy is different from deep tissue massage, chiropractic manipulation or forceful stretching. It uses small, precise rolling movements over muscles, fascia and soft tissue, with short pauses between each set of movements. These pauses are an important part of the treatment, giving your body time to process and respond.

How Back Pain Can Affect The Whole Body
 

Back pain is not always isolated to one area. A tight lower back may affect the hips, pelvis, legs, shoulders or neck. Pain in the back can also change the way you walk, sit, stand and breathe.

Over time, the body may begin to compensate. One area tightens to protect another. Movement becomes guarded. Muscles may stay switched on for longer than they need to. This can create a cycle of discomfort, stiffness and reduced confidence in movement.

Bowen Therapy, Movement And Back Pain Recovery
 

For many types of back pain, gentle movement and staying active are often recommended as part of recovery. NHS guidance lists options such as group exercise, physiotherapy, manual therapy and cognitive behavioural therapy for some types of back pain, depending on the individual situation. NICE guidance also says manual therapy, including soft tissue techniques, may be considered as part of a wider treatment package that includes exercise. 
 

Bowen Therapy sits within this broader picture as a gentle bodywork approach. It does not replace medical advice, physiotherapy, exercise or assessment where these are needed. Instead, it can be used as complementary support, particularly for people who want a non-invasive treatment that works with both soft tissue and the nervous system.

What To Expect From A Bowen Therapy Session In Bristol
 

Your session at e a s e will begin with a consultation. This gives us time to understand your back pain, how long it has been present, what makes it better or worse, and how it is affecting your daily life.
 

You will usually lie comfortably on a treatment couch, although sessions can be adapted if lying down is uncomfortable. Bowen Therapy can often be carried out through light clothing.

During the treatment, small rolling movements are made over specific points of the body. After a few movements, there are pauses. These pauses allow your body time to respond and are an essential part of the Bowen approach.
 

A session may feel deeply relaxing. Some people notice warmth, tingling, softening, a sense of release or a feeling that their body is becoming more settled. Others simply feel calm and rested.

After treatment, you may feel lighter, looser, tired, more aware of your posture, or more comfortable in your movement. Some people notice changes straight away, while others feel the effects unfold over the following days.

When To Seek Medical Advice For Back Pain
 

Most back pain is not caused by anything serious, but it is important to seek medical advice if you are concerned or if symptoms are severe, unusual or worsening.
 

You should contact a GP or medical professional if your back pain follows a fall or injury, does not improve, is accompanied by unexplained weight loss, fever, numbness, weakness, changes in bladder or bowel control, or pain that is severe at night.
 

Bowen Therapy can be supportive, but it is not a substitute for medical assessment where this is needed.
